#asktheexperts my daughter is 1 years 1 month , her weight and height are 7.8 kg and 73 cm respectively. her birth weight was 2.9 kg. she eats less but quite active can walk lil bit. is she fine.

1 Answer
Sonam PrasadMom of 2 children3 years ago
A. hi dear While all children may grow at a different rate, the following indicates the average for 1-year-old boys and girls: Weight: average gain of about 8 ounces each month, birthweight has tripled by the end of the first year. Height: average growth of about 1/4 to 1/2 inch each month.
